Head to the amazing Heights of Abraham in Matlock Bath where you can reach the stunning hilltop park via a cable car ride, with cavern tours and walking trails to discover at the top. Learn of the local history at the Peak District Mining Museum and explore the interactive exhibits and uncover the life of a Derbyshire Lead Miner. A family friendly adventure can be found at Matlock Farm Park which is home to a host of lovely animals and a fantastic play area to keep the little ones entertained, as well as a riding school here too. Head back in time to Crich Tramway Village and take a trip through history at The National Tramway Museum, or explore the magnificent Chatsworth House in Bakewell, a filming location for the feature film Pride & Prejudice as the handsome Mr Darcy's Pemberley Manor, it is set within vast grounds and is filled with a magnificent collection including artefacts from Ancient Egypt, some of Europe's best art collections, and modern sculpture.
